How much does it cost to live alone in Cowbridge?

Living alone in Cowbridge usually costs more than sharing, as you cover the full rent and utilities yourself. On average, property to rent in Cowbridge costs around 1480 £ per month, with cheaper options from 1195 £.

Typical monthly expenses include:

  • utilities (£150–£250)
  • groceries (£180–£280)
  • transport (£150–£200)
  • council tax (£120–£180)

Everyday costs like phone plans or streaming services usually add around £30–£60 per month. The average monthly salary in the UK is roughly £2,300–£2,600 after tax, so careful budgeting is essential when living alone in Cowbridge.
